Intimate Encounter: Nanny Goat and Kid (1660s) In this exquisite etching by Dutch master Marcus de Bye, a nanny goat tenderly gazes at her kid as they rest together in the rolling hills of rural Netherlands. Created during the Golden Age of Dutch art, circa 1660s, this print showcases De Bye's exceptional skill in capturing the quiet moments between animals and humans. The nanny goat's direct gaze is both protective and affectionate, conveying a deep maternal bond with her young companion. The kid looks up at its mother with wide eyes, trusting in her care and guidance. This tender scene invites us to pause and appreciate the simple joys of life on the farm during this era. De Bye's masterful use of black ink creates a striking contrast between light and dark, drawing our attention to every detail - from the soft texture of their coats to the subtle playfulness in their expressions. As we gaze upon this 17th-century masterpiece, we are reminded that even in times past, animals were cherished for their companionship and value. This print is part of a remarkable collection held at Te Papa Museum Tongarewa (Museum of New Zealand), offering us a window into the world of Dutch heritage art.
